Rebranding to SUPERWISE® Reflects Commitment to AI-Driven Solutions for Enhanced Efficiency, Security, Governance, and Observability
Blattner Technologies today announced its official rebrand to SUPERWISE®, aligning its corporate identity with the industry-leading AI platform it acquired in 2023. The move cements SUPERWISE’s® position as a premier provider of AI-driven solutions for real-world industries, delivering AI that is practical, scalable, and designed to empower teams with intelligent decision-making capabilities. With a focus on observability, monitoring, and governance, SUPERWISE® ensures AI models remain transparent, reliable, and compliant across their lifecycle.
SUPERWISE® has been recognized by Gartner as a Cool Vendor in the 2020 Enterprise AI Governance report and cited in multiple 2023 Hype Cycle reports for Explainable AI. The platform provides advanced model monitoring, incident investigation, and optimization tools for enterprise AI. Since its acquisition by Blattner Technologies, SUPERWISE® has been central to the company’s Predictive Transformation strategy, enabling industries like manufacturing, construction, healthcare, and commerce to deploy and manage AI effectively. By integrating governance and observability into its offerings, SUPERWISE® delivers a robust framework for enterprises to oversee AI performance and compliance at scale.

The transition from Blattner Technologies to SUPERWISE® is effective immediately, with an updated corporate website and branding now live at www.SUPERWISE.ai. Existing customers will continue to receive the same high-quality service and solutions, now under a unified brand identity.
